文件名称:核心:MyAEGEE的核心模块,管理用户,本地组和成员身份
文件大小:328KB
文件格式:ZIP
更新时间:2024-02-29 05:57:40
hacktoberfest JavaScript
核心 这次是在JS中实现MyAEGEE的主要部分oms-core。 使用的技术 Node.js + JS PostgreSQL作为数据库 表示为网络服务器 续作ORM 文件夹结构 config/ -应用程序配置 models/ -ORM型号 migrations/ -数据库迁移 middlewares/ -端点中间件(主要用于处理请求的功能) test/ -与测试相关的所有内容 docker/ -与运行和构建Docker映像并将此映像用作MyAEGEE的补丁有关的所有内容 lib/ -其余的差不多。 lib/server.js端点列表和实际的服务器启动 lib/cron.js后台任务和运行它们的包装器 lib/permission-manager.js一个用于计算权限相关内容的类 我如何... ...运行测试? 只需在本地文件夹中运行npm test 。 不要忘记运行Node.